Kru Alex Palma Seminar

Written by Danny Valle
Saturday, 08 October 2011

Big thanks to Kru Alex Palma for conducting a fantastic seminar at our Serra BJJ Huntington academy this past Saturday, October 8. Over 45 students took the four-hour class, a great turnout for what was Serra BJJ’s very first Muay Thai kickboxing seminar.

Kru Alex's instruction is top-notch; it’s easy to see why he coaches elite fighters like the Nogueira brothers, Anderson Silva and Jose Aldo just to name a few. If you didn't get a chance to participate, you truly missed a great opportunity to learn from a champion veteran. But don't feel too bad, we plan on having Alex back soon.

In addition to the seminar, Kru Alex had a surprise for our very own James Gabert, Serra BJJ’s head Muay Thai instructor. James was promoted to the rank of Kru by Alex! In addition to his great work as an instructor, Kru James dedicates much of his time to training up-and-coming fighters in both kickboxing and MMA.

4-for-4 at Ring of Combat 36

Written by Danny Valle
Monday, 20 June 2011

Many congratulations are in order for the Serra-Longo fight team, who went 4-for-4 at Ring of Combat 36 in Atlantic City last Friday, June 17, with each and every fighter showing the heart, tenacity and spirit quickly becoming synonymous with their powerhouse teams.

UFC veteran Pete “Drago” Sell weathered opponent Elijah Harshbarger’s relentless first-round attacks before securing a reverse-triangle/straight armbar that left Harshbargar tapping at 3:24 of round two. The win earned Drago the ROC “National” welterweight title, and proved what all Pete’s teammates already knew: Drago is a beast!

In another extremely exciting match, Al Iaquinta battled through an opening-round assault before coming back and securing a split decision win over opponent Gabriel Miglioli. Rounding out the night of victories were James Jenkins and Ed “Truck” Gordon, who both won by unanimous decision.

All of the fighters of the night displayed extreme heart and overcame any and all adversities to secure well-deserved wins.
